COMEDK 2025 UGET Exam: The Association of Medical, Engineering and Dental Colleges of Karnataka (COMEDK) has started the application process for the COMEDK UGET 2025 exam. The exam is conducted every year for students seeking admission to engineering colleges across Karnataka. Interested candidates can now apply online for the COMEDK UGET 2025 exam on the official website comedk.org.
COMEDK Registration: Last Date to Apply
The application process for COMEDK UGET 2025 will begin on
February 3, 2025. Candidates who wish to apply are urged to complete their
registration and submit their applications by March 15, 2025.
COMEDK UGET 2025: Eligibility Criteria
The student must have passed their Class 12 exams or
equivalent exams with Physics, Chemistry, Mathematics, and English subjects.
For general ability candidates, a minimum of 45 per cent marks in Physics,
Chemistry, and Mathematics are required, while candidates from SC/ST/OBC
categories need at least 40 per cent marks. Physics and Mathematics are
compulsory subjects, and candidates can choose one of the following optional
subjects: Chemistry, Biology, Biotechnology, Computer Science, or Electronics.
Also, only candidates who appear for the entrance exam will be considered for the ranking list. It is important to understand that candidates holding diplomas are not ineligible to apply for the examination, as there are no provisions allowing for lateral entry into the courses.
COMEDK UGET 2025 Registration Fees:
The registration fee for the COMEDK UGET 2025 is Rs 1,950, (excluding
of taxes or convenience fees if applicable), for candidates who are applying
for the engineering examination. For those candidates applying to both
engineering (BE/BTech) and medical programs, the registration fee is Rs 3,200
(excluding of taxes or convenience fees if any).
COMEDK UGET 2025 Exam Pattern:
COMEDK UGET 2025 is a three-hour exam and will have a total of 180 questions. Each question will carry one mark. The exam will be divided into three sections: Physics, Chemistry and Mathematics (PCM). It is important to note that the exam pattern is different for candidates applying for engineering and medical courses.
Engineering Colleges accepting COMEDK UGET Score for B.Tech
in India:
Around 200+ engineering colleges in India accept COMEDK UGET
scores. Out of these, 150+ colleges are privately owned and 8 colleges are
owned by public/government organizations. COMEDK UGET is one of the widely
accepted entrance exams in the top engineering colleges in Karnataka. Ramaiah
Institute of Technology, R.V. College of Engineering, BMS College of
Engineering and many others are some of the top engineering colleges in India
that accept COMEDK UGET scores.
